Wood vs. Composite Decks:
Which Is Right for You?
Choosing the right material for your new deck comes down to what matters most to you: budget, maintenance, aesthetics, and how long you want it to last. Here’s a side-by-side breakdown to help you decide between pressure-treated wood and composite decking.
Pressure-Treated Wood Decks
Best for homeowners who prefer a traditional look and don’t mind a little upkeep to save on cost.
Pros
Lower upfront cost — great for budgeting
Natural wood appearance with classic charm
Easy to customize with paint or stain
Can be sanded and refinished over time
Keep In Mind:
Requires staining/sealing every 1–2 years
Can warp, splinter, or crack over time
Typically lasts 10–15 years with proper care
More prone to moisture and insect damage
Composite Decking
Best for homeowners who want low-maintenance living and long-term durability with a modern finish.
Pros
Long-lasting, often with 25–50 year warranties
Won’t warp, crack, splinter, or fade
No need to stain, paint, or seal
Available in a variety of colors and grain patterns
Made from eco-friendly, recycled materials
Keep In Mind:
Higher initial cost than wood
Can get warmer in direct sunlight
Needs structural framing
